动态表格怎么转换成excel

动态表格怎么转换成excel

动态表格可以通过导出功能、编写脚本、使用第三方工具、以及手动复制粘贴的方式转换成Excel。其中,最常用且高效的方法是使用导出功能和编写脚本。下面将详细介绍如何通过这些方式将动态表格转换成Excel。

一、导出功能

导出功能是最直接和便捷的方法之一。许多在线平台和软件都提供了导出为Excel文件的功能。

1. 使用在线平台的导出功能

许多在线表格工具,如Google Sheets、Airtable等,都提供了直接导出为Excel文件的功能。这些工具通常在其菜单栏中提供导出选项。

  • Google Sheets:打开你的Google Sheets文档,点击“文件”菜单,然后选择“下载”,选择“Microsoft Excel (.xlsx)”选项。文件将自动下载到你的计算机。
  • Airtable:在Airtable中,点击右上角的“导出”按钮,然后选择“下载为CSV”。你可以使用Excel打开CSV文件并进行进一步处理。

2. 使用软件的导出功能

一些桌面软件也提供导出为Excel的功能。例如,Microsoft Access、Tableau等工具都可以将数据导出为Excel文件。

  • Microsoft Access:在Access中,打开你的数据库,选择你要导出的表格,然后点击“外部数据”选项卡,选择“Excel”选项并按照提示操作。
  • Tableau:在Tableau中,选择你要导出的视图,点击“数据”菜单,然后选择“导出数据”并选择“Excel”。

二、编写脚本

如果你需要定期将动态表格转换成Excel文件,编写脚本是一个高效且自动化的解决方案。

1. 使用Python脚本

Python是一种强大的编程语言,能够轻松处理数据并生成Excel文件。下面是一个简单的Python脚本示例,使用pandas和openpyxl库将动态表格转换成Excel文件。

import pandas as pd

读取动态表格数据,假设数据来源是一个CSV文件

data = pd.read_csv('dynamic_table.csv')

将数据写入Excel文件

data.to_excel('output.xlsx', index=False)

2. 使用VBA脚本

如果你习惯使用Excel,你也可以使用VBA(Visual Basic for Applications)脚本来自动化转换过程。

Sub ExportToExcel()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("DynamicTable")

' 创建一个新的工作簿

Dim newWorkbook As Workbook

Set newWorkbook = Workbooks.Add

' 复制动态表格数据到新工作簿

ws.UsedRange.Copy Destination:=newWorkbook.Sheets(1).Range("A1")

' 保存新工作簿为Excel文件

newWorkbook.SaveAs Filename:="output.xlsx", FileFormat:=xlOpenXMLWorkbook

newWorkbook.Close

End Sub

三、使用第三方工具

一些第三方工具专门用于数据转换,可以帮助你将动态表格转换成Excel文件。

1. 使用在线转换工具

一些在线转换工具,如Convertio、Zamzar等,提供将各种格式的文件转换为Excel的功能。你只需上传动态表格文件,选择输出格式为Excel,然后下载转换后的文件。

2. 使用桌面转换软件

一些桌面软件,如Able2Extract、PDF2XL等,也提供将动态表格转换为Excel的功能。这些软件通常具有更高的灵活性和更强大的功能。

四、手动复制粘贴

如果你的动态表格数据量不大,手动复制粘贴也是一种可行的方法。

1. 复制动态表格数据

打开你的动态表格,选择你要复制的数据,然后按下Ctrl+C(Windows)或Command+C(Mac)进行复制。

2. 粘贴到Excel

打开Excel,选择一个空白工作表,然后按下Ctrl+V(Windows)或Command+V(Mac)进行粘贴。你可以根据需要对数据进行进一步处理和格式化。

总结

将动态表格转换成Excel文件的方法多种多样,包括导出功能、编写脚本、使用第三方工具、以及手动复制粘贴。根据你的需求和技术水平,选择最适合你的方法。导出功能是最直接和便捷的方法,而编写脚本则适用于需要定期进行转换的场景。使用第三方工具和手动复制粘贴也有其适用的场景。无论选择哪种方法,都能帮助你高效地将动态表格转换成Excel文件。

相关问答FAQs:

1. 如何将动态表格转换为Excel文件?

转换动态表格为Excel文件非常简单。首先,确保你的动态表格已经完成并保存好。然后,按照以下步骤进行转换:

  • 打开动态表格所在的软件或网页,将其导出为CSV(逗号分隔值)文件格式。
  • 打开Excel软件,点击“文件”选项卡,选择“打开”。
  • 在打开文件对话框中,选择刚刚导出的CSV文件,点击“打开”。
  • Excel会自动打开CSV文件,并将其转换为Excel格式。在转换过程中,你可能需要按照Excel的提示进行一些调整,如选择分隔符、数据格式等。
  • 保存转换后的Excel文件,你现在就可以在Excel中对其进行编辑、格式化和分享了。

2. 我该如何将网页上的动态表格导出为Excel文件?

将网页上的动态表格导出为Excel文件可以通过以下步骤实现:

  • 首先,使用鼠标右键点击动态表格,选择“复制”或“复制表格”。
  • 打开Excel软件,点击“文件”选项卡,选择“新建”。
  • 在新建文件中,使用鼠标右键点击单元格,选择“粘贴”。
  • Excel会自动将复制的动态表格粘贴到新建文件中,并将其转换为Excel格式。
  • 保存转换后的Excel文件,你现在就可以在Excel中对其进行编辑、格式化和分享了。

3. 如何将动态表格转换为Excel文件,同时保留表格中的公式?

要将动态表格转换为Excel文件并保留其中的公式,可以按照以下步骤操作:

  • 首先,确保动态表格中的公式已经正确设置。
  • 将动态表格导出为CSV(逗号分隔值)文件格式。
  • 打开Excel软件,点击“文件”选项卡,选择“打开”。
  • 在打开文件对话框中,选择刚刚导出的CSV文件,点击“打开”。
  • Excel会自动打开CSV文件,并将其转换为Excel格式。在转换过程中,公式会被保留。
  • 保存转换后的Excel文件,你现在就可以在Excel中对其进行编辑、格式化和分享了。

请注意,转换过程中,确保Excel软件与动态表格所在的软件或网页兼容,以确保公式的正确转换和保留。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4376017

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部